Ответ 1
Вы можете загрузить bundler как файл .gem
из rubygems и установить его на сервере с помощью
gem install /path/to/bundler.gem
Затем вы можете упаковать все драгоценные камни, необходимые для вашего приложения, в каталог ./vendor/cache
с помощью
bundle package
Если теперь вы развернете свое приложение (вместе с ./vendor/cache
) на сервере и запустите
bundle install --local
bundler не перейдет к rubygems, а вместо этого установит все драгоценные камни из каталога ./vendor/cache
.
Подробнее см. bundler-package
docs.